WASHINGTON (MarketWatch)
Food price forecasts from the United States
Department of Agriculture were kept steady Wednesday, with the government still
forecasting 2.5% to 3.5% growth this year and 3% to 4% growth next year
The
full extent of the drought and its effect on commodity prices are as yet
unknown, the USDA said
